EXAMPLE

Retrieving properties from a magnetic card

In this example, the rules above have been stored in the registry by the installation script.

The following data is received from the device:

%B1234567890074589^SMITH/JOHN Q.MR^9912101254700000000000123? ;1234567890074589=991210112547?

Format 1 (ISO59) would not be applied because the first two digits of track 2 are not 59. Format 2 (BankCardA) would not be applied since there is not an ‘A’ following the start sentinel. However, the data fits the template for format 2 (BankCard).

The following properties and their corresponding values will be exposed:

LastName

Æ

“SMITH”

FirstName

Æ

“JOHN”

MidName

Æ

“Q”

Title

Æ

“SMITH”

DiscData1

Æ

“254700000000000123”

PAN

Æ

“1234567890074589”

ExpDate

Æ

“9912”

SrvCode

Æ

“101”

DiscData2

Æ

“12547”

The application receives the successful read response /read M00900 <card data>.
